独特飞机

文章
9
资源
0
加入时间
2年10月17天

STL---map知识例题

知识map数组遍历下标从1开始其实map就差不多相当于一个可以开很大的桶。map的特点:1、存储Key-value对2、支持快速查找,查找的复杂度基本是Log(N)3、快速插入,快速删除,快速修改multimap特性以及用法与map完全相同,唯一的差别在于允许重复键值的元素插入容器.例题【51nod】和为k的连续区间分析map存储前缀和是s的数的下标。每次判断有没有前缀和是sum-k的。上代码#include<iostream>#includ

海盗分赃(25分)

P 个海盗偷了 D 颗钻石后来到公海分赃,一致同意如下分赃策略:首先,P 个海盗通过抽签决定 1 - P 的序号。然后由第 1 号海盗提出一个分配方案(方案应给出每个海盗分得的具体数量),如果能够得到包括 1 号在内的绝对多数(即大于半数)同意,则按照该分配方案执行,否则 1 号将被投入大海喂鲨鱼;而后依次类似地由第 2 号、第 3 号等等海盗提出方案,直到能够获得绝对多数同意的方案出现为止,或者只剩下最后一位海盗,其独占所有钻石。请编写一个程序,给出第 1 号海盗的钻石分配方案中自己分得的钻石

嵌入式学习:stm32学习路线推荐之思维导图

从9月1日开始学习STM32后,对于STM32的一些个人总结:1.对于STM32和51的区别:对于 STM32来说,基本的大概都和51单片的内容相似,但是由于STM的引脚和寄存器的数量较多,所以需要一个更加完善的管理机制,导致了—时钟 的产生。2.对于STM32来说,一般文件都是分为3个部分组成的(正点原子版):1. .C文件 2. 。H文件 3.main函数 其中.c文件...